DESCRIPTION
The cPCI500 is a high-reliability, 500W, 6ux4HP
CompactPCI™ power supply operating from wide-
range DC-input. The use of our patented V-Series
topology yields high efficiency which consequently
permits packaging of this product in a compact, single
card slot format (4HP).
ORing diodes and current sharing allow the cPCI500 to
be operated in N+n parallel-redundant configurations.
Available with an IPMI interface option, the cPCI500
was designed for hot-swap, redundant configurations
to support high-availability (HA) telecom applications.
With a widerange input of 36-72Vdc, safety agency
approvals to UL60950 and EN60950, EMI compliance
to ETSI and Telcordia standards, the cPCI500 was
designed with globally-deployed systems in mind.
Additional features include remote sense compensation,
unit enable control (EN#), output inhibit control (INH#),
output fault signal (FAL#), and thermal warning signal
(DEG#). LEDs are provided for visual indication of input
power presence and output fault condition.
The 4HP package and complement of global
safety agency approvals provide for an advanced,
high-density, high-efficiency power solution for your
CompactPCI requirements.

Output Overload Protection
Conditions/Response
Outputs are individually protected against overloads and indefinite short circuit with automatic recovery upon removal of the fault condition.
Design Verification Testing (DVT) confirms that voltage excursions on the output buses resulting from insertion/extraction events do not exceed the
specified maximum of 5%. However, routing of power and signal lines in the mating backplane is critical to minimization of such excursions. In
addition, performance can be critically affected by load characteristics including resistance, negative resistance, and reactive components. While
the control loop responses have been designed for optimum hot-swap performance over a wide range of characteristics, there may be instances
where the voltage excursions exceed published specifications. In such cases, the control loop responses can be modified to perform optimally.
Output isolation devices are present in all outputs to isolate faults within a failed power supply.

IPMI/IPMB POWER SUPPLY SATELLITE CONTROLLER FEATURES
Complies with IPMI V1.5 Rev 1.1 and IPMB V1.0
Complies to PICMG2.9 (CompactPCI Systems Management
Specification)
8 Analog inputs configured for monitoring voltages and currents on
power supply outputs V1 - V4
Monitors the state of the thermal sensor
Output inhibit control can be overwritten by IPMI commands
Self Test with LED indicator (can be read and overwritten by IPMI
commands)
6 programmable thresholds on each analog sensor
Each threshold on each sensor can be enabled to generate event
messages if that threshold is crossed
Thermal sensor can be enabled to generate event messages
Responds to all mandatory IPMI commands and numerous optional
commands as indicated in the functional specification
Firmware can be upgraded via the IPMB bus
Includes Device SDR’s (Sensor Data Records) - These specify the type
of sensor for each input (voltage, current, temperature, etc.) as well as
the conversion formulas from raw ADC data to voltages, currents, etc.
Includes FRU type information such as Model Number, serial number
and firmware creation date
